[www.golfweek.com stories] LPGA remodels qualifying school process: Stage 1 qualifying will take place July 26-29 at LPGA International in Daytona Beach, Fla., on the Champions Course. Eligible players include those who are not a member of a recognized Rolex-ranked women’s golf tour, or are not ranked in the top 100 of the Rolex Rankings as of July 12.

[myLPGA] Changes to Q-School: The summary of the changes for players hoping for status in 2012 is that there will be, depending on a golfer's current status, up to three stages instead of two, no separate Futures Tour qualifier and eliminating the "mulligan" whereby a player who failed to qualify in one sectional crossed the continent and played the other to try to reach the final stage.

[LPGA.com News & Entertainment] Tseng Solidifies Hold on No. 1 in Rolex - LPGA.com: Arguably the hottest player on the planet, over the last 11 months, Tseng has won four times on the LPGA Tour, including twice at major championships - the 2010 Kraft Nabisco Championship and the 2010 RICOH Women's British Open - and another three times internationally. After two events on the LPGA Tour in 2011, Tseng holds the early lead for the LPGA Official money list title and Vare Trophy, and she is tied with Webb for Rolex Player of the Year honors.
